Output 26399abb30aac2eb56c55fd98809d919f5cd2e928eb45e271a7624d2c0ab9098:1

value
688215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7655ced5af9ae811b2c70cae77e3e96e2fc86385 OP_EQUAL
address
3CUiTDk1VSNPU3KeRenmwowkq4ESqWdbAA
transaction
26399abb30aac2eb56c55fd98809d919f5cd2e928eb45e271a7624d2c0ab9098
spent
true